Responsibilities:
- Plan and coordinate daily activities and programs for senior residents in a Care home
- Develop engaging and stimulating activities that promote physical, mental, and emotional well-being
- Create a monthly activity calendar and distribute to residents and staff
- Lead group activities such as exercise classes, arts and crafts, games, and outings
- Provide one-on-one support and companionship to residents who may require additional assistance
- Collaborate with other staff members to ensure a safe and enjoyable environment for all residents
- Maintain documentation of resident participation and progress
Experience:
- Previous experience working with seniors in care home setting
- Knowledge of dementia care techniques and strategies
-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written
- Ability to empathize with and understand the needs of seniors
- Strong organizational skills and the ability to multitask effectively
